    Delicious! However, mine were slightly different. My boy can't have dairy so I used organic earth balance whipped spread, a cup of it in place of butter. It worked perfectly, And I'm sure you could use oil instead of eggs if your full blown vegan. I also added a touch of cinnamon, it gives it a nice hint of fall flavor. semisweet or dark chocolate chips taste best. And 10 min is perfect!

    My boyfriend loved the cookies. I thought they were okay. I guess I would just prefer original chocolate chip cookies.. I thought the cocoa powder was a little sickening. I did add 2 tablespoons to the milk like others suggested which resulted in a really good consistency for the batter. The outcome was some deliciously soft and chewy cookies! I also added one package of vanilla pudding mix.. a habit I have when making cookies because I have heard it keeps them soft. I also substituted half of the chocolate chips with white chocolate chips. I also cooked them at 350 for about 11 minutes.. my cookies were on the large side. Overall, a good recipe!
